Release Management
Implementierung von Release-Management-Verfahren zur Gewährleistung reibungsloser und kontrollierter API-Releases.
Ergebnisse
Abschnitt betitelt „Ergebnisse“- Kontrollierte und reibungslose API-Freigaben
Verwandte U-Bahnlinien
Abschnitt betitelt „Verwandte U-Bahnlinien“Warum das wichtig ist
Abschnitt betitelt „Warum das wichtig ist“Ein effektives Versionsmanagement ist unerlässlich, um sicherzustellen, dass API-Versionen reibungslos, kontrolliert und auf die Geschäftsanforderungen abgestimmt sind. Diese Station bietet Richtlinien für die Verwaltung von API-Releases, einschließlich Versionierung, Bereitstellungsstrategien und Rollback-Verfahren.
Wie es funktioniert
Abschnitt betitelt „Wie es funktioniert“- Definieren Sie Versionsstrategien für APIs, um Änderungen zu verwalten und Abwärtskompatibilität zu gewährleisten. Bewährte Praktiken der API-Versionierung Strategien für die Einführung, Pflege und Abschaffung von API-Versionen unter Wahrung der Abwärtskompatibilität und des Vertrauens der Verbraucher.
- Implementierung von Bereitstellungsstrategien (z. B. blau-grüne Bereitstellungen, Canary-Releases) zur Minimierung der Risiken bei API-Releases. APIOps CI/CD für APIs Bereitstellungsleitfaden, der die Aufgaben des API-Lebenszyklus - Entwurf, Tests, Governance - in die Pipelines für die kontinuierliche Integration und Bereitstellung integriert.
- Einführung von Rollback-Verfahren zur schnellen Rückgängigmachung von Änderungen im Falle von Problemen bei API-Releases.
Bei Ihrer Arbeit anwenden
Abschnitt betitelt „Bei Ihrer Arbeit anwenden“Bereitstellung von Rahmenwerken für die Versionsverwaltung, Richtlinien für die Versionierung und Strategien für die Bereitstellung. Sicherstellen, dass die Teams Best Practices für die Verwaltung von API-Releases befolgen, einschließlich Versionierung, Bereitstellung und Rollback-Verfahren.